WebKey Differences between Abstraction and Data Hiding. Abstraction shows only the essential information and hides the non-essential details. On the other hand, data hiding is used to hide the data from the components of the program by ensuring exclusive data access to class members. Web28 mrt. 2024 · Data hiding refers to a concept of object-oriented programming. The security of members of a certain class from unrecognized access is confirmed by the process of Data hiding. It protects the data and its members from being hacked. If data is hacked, it can lead to leakage of information or illegal manipulation.
